Amer Sports' Winter Sports Operations have received the Austrian Phoenix...
Amer Sports' Winter Sports Operations have received the Austrian Phoenix 2014 waste management award for their production site in Altenmarkt, Austria. Dakine has announced the launch of its first-ever surf apparel...
Dakine has announced the launch of its first-ever surf apparel collection for spring 2015. The 35-year-old American outdoor brand is known for its backpacks, bags, gloves and accessories for surf, skate, snowboard, ski, mountain bike, windsurf and kite. Décathlon has announced the termination of a sponsorship deal with...
Décathlon has announced the termination of a sponsorship deal with Camille Muffat for its private brand of swimwear, Nabaiji, because the Olympic champion is ending her professional career for personal reasons. Two other swimming professionals, Fabien Gilot and Fabrice Pellerin, continue to endorse Nabaiji.

One Way Sport will become the main sponsor of Snowproof...
One Way Sport will become the main sponsor of Snowproof Racing, a long-distance cross-country team based in Austria. The newly-signed partnership includes naming rights, apparel, roller skis, running shoes as well as ski wax and lasts until 2017. Accell Netherlands is to open a 10,000-square-meter cycling experience center...
Accell Netherlands is to open a 10,000-square-meter cycling experience center in Ede. The new space will be called “De Fietser” (The Cyclist) and its opening is scheduled for summer 2015.
